Torque versus angular displacement response of human head to-Gx impact acceleration.

Abstract

Results of a comparison of 41 previously reported test runs and human volunteer runs in testing torque versus angular displacement response of the human head to-Gx impact acceleration. Due to different instrumentation and measuring techniques, there were several differences, but large portions of data were comparable. The need for anatomically based three-dimensional coordinate systems to permit quantitative comparisons between human subjects is pointed out.
